Differences

Reasons to consider the NVIDIA Quadro P400

  • Videocard is newer: launch date 6 year(s) 1 month(s) later
  • Around 69% higher core clock speed: 1228 MHz vs 725 MHz
  • Around 22% higher texture fill rate: 21.25 GTexel / s vs 17.4 GTexel / s
  • A newer manufacturing process allows for a more powerful, yet cooler running videocard: 14 nm vs 40 nm
  • Around 17% lower typical power consumption: 30 Watt vs 35 Watt
  • 2x more maximum memory size: 2 GB vs 1 GB
  • Around 11% higher memory clock speed: 4012 MHz vs 3600 MHz
  • Around 25% better performance in PassMark - G3D Mark: 1639 vs 1314
  • 2.5x better performance in Geekbench - OpenCL: 3053 vs 1206
  • 16.8x better performance in CompuBench 1.5 Desktop - Face Detection (mPixels/s): 20.138 vs 1.199
  • 2.6x better performance in CompuBench 1.5 Desktop - T-Rex (Frames/s): 1.391 vs 0.535
  • Around 54% better performance in CompuBench 1.5 Desktop - Video Composition (Frames/s): 24.886 vs 16.137
  • Around 27% better performance in CompuBench 1.5 Desktop - Bitcoin Mining (mHash/s): 84.858 vs 66.638
  • Around 77% better performance in GFXBench 4.0 - Car Chase Offscreen (Frames): 2709 vs 1528
  • Around 11% better performance in GFXBench 4.0 - Manhattan (Frames): 2875 vs 2590
  • Around 77% better performance in GFXBench 4.0 - Car Chase Offscreen (Fps): 2709 vs 1528
  • Around 11% better performance in GFXBench 4.0 - Manhattan (Fps): 2875 vs 2590

Reasons to consider the AMD FirePro M5950

  • Around 88% higher pipelines: 480 vs 256
  • Around 2% better floating-point performance: 696.0 gflops vs 679.9 gflops
  • Around 30% better performance in PassMark - G2D Mark: 574 vs 443
  • Around 2% better performance in CompuBench 1.5 Desktop - Ocean Surface Simulation (Frames/s): 323.699 vs 318.72
  • Around 1% better performance in GFXBench 4.0 - T-Rex (Frames): 3354 vs 3328
  • Around 1% better performance in GFXBench 4.0 - T-Rex (Fps): 3354 vs 3328
